US Stamps Covers and Philately For Sale: 19th Century Used 

 

Used stamps and other philatelic releases from the USA during the 19th century. Provisional Issues by Postmasters in 1846, the first general issue in 1847 (the first US stamp issue), through to the Trans-Mississippi Exposition Issues of 1897.
